pollux (192.168.178.165) wedged at the network level during an
end-to-end install test today — mkinitcpio on a 4 GiB smoke VM +
the cached 1.5 GB ISO + a busy runner container pushed the host into
OOM, taking pveproxy and the SSH path down with it. Recovered by
physical reset.

Smoke VM now defaults to 8192 MiB / 2 vCPU, configurable via
PVE_TEST_VM_MEMORY / PVE_TEST_VM_CORES. Host has 64 GiB, so one
smoke VM at 8 GiB is well within headroom.

The delete branch required Datastore.Allocate (or was hitting a
privilege-separated token ACL edge case) and produced 403s on re-runs
against the same commit SHA. Since the ISO bytes are reproducible for
a given SHA — furtka-<sha>.iso is content-addressed — we can just
reuse whatever is already in PVE storage instead of cycling it.

Fixes the "runs-on-same-sha" re-dispatch case without needing any extra
PVE permission, and shaves ~2 min off repeated smoke runs.

After build-iso, a new smoke-vm job uploads the freshly built ISO to
the test Proxmox at 192.168.178.165 via PVE API token, boots it in a
fresh VM (VMID range 9000-9099, MAC derived from commit SHA so the
runner can find the DHCP IP by scanning the LAN), and curls :5000 to
confirm the webinstaller answers HTTP 200. Last 5 smoke VMs + their
ISOs are kept for post-mortem; older ones are purged. continue-on-error
on the smoke job so a VM-side flake doesn't mark the ISO build red.

Shortens the feedback loop on ISO regressions from "next manual VM
test session" (days) to "next push" (minutes) — the 2026-04-15/16 VM
sessions each found real boot-time bugs that unit tests missed.

Docs at docs/smoke-vm.md. Requires Forgejo secrets PVE_TEST_HOST and
PVE_TEST_TOKEN (dedicated smoke@pve!ci PVE token, privilege-separated).
